1. Understanding Crane Sheaves: A Vital Component in Lifting Operations
Crane sheaves are pulleys designed to guide and support the lifting ropes or cables used in crane operations. These components are crucial for distributing loads evenly and minimizing friction during lifting. By understanding the mechanics behind crane sheaves, we can appreciate their role in ensuring safe lifting operations.
The primary function of a crane sheave is to change the direction of the lifting force, allowing operators to lift and maneuver heavy loads effectively. Sheaves come in various sizes and designs, each tailored for specific lifting requirements. A well-designed sheave not only facilitates smooth operation but also significantly reduces the wear and tear on the lifting ropes, prolonging their lifespan.
2. The Role of Crane Sheaves in Load Management
In lifting operations, managing loads effectively is crucial to preventing accidents and ensuring safety. Crane sheaves contribute to load management in several ways:
- **Load Distribution:** Sheaves help distribute the weight of the load evenly across the lifting system. This balance is essential for maintaining stability during lifting operations.
- **Reduced Friction:** A well-designed sheave minimizes friction between the lifting cable and the sheave, allowing for smoother operation and reducing the risk of cable damage.
- **Enhanced Control:** Crane sheaves provide operators with better control over the lifting process, enabling precise movements of heavy loads.
When crane sheaves are properly utilized, they significantly enhance the safety and efficiency of lifting operations.
3. Selecting the Right Crane Sheave for Your Project
Choosing the appropriate crane sheave is critical for maximizing safety and efficiency in lifting operations. Key factors to consider include:
3.1 Material Considerations
Crane sheaves are typically made from materials such as steel, aluminum, or nylon. The material chosen should align with the intended lifting application. Steel sheaves offer robust strength and durability for heavy loads, while aluminum sheaves are lighter and suitable for lighter applications. Nylon sheaves, though less common, can be used in situations where corrosion resistance is essential.
3.2 Design and Size
The design and size of a crane sheave directly affect its performance. Sheaves come in various designs, including fixed, swivel, and block sheaves. The size should correspond to the diameter of the lifting rope to ensure a snug fit that minimizes wear.
3.3 Load Capacity and Safety Margins
Every crane sheave has a specific load capacity, which should be clearly marked. It is crucial to select sheaves that can handle the maximum expected load, factoring in safety margins to accommodate unforeseen circumstances.
4. Maintenance Practices for Crane Sheaves
Regular maintenance of crane sheaves is essential for ensuring their longevity and performance. Here are some best practices:
4.1 Regular Inspections
Routine inspections are necessary to identify signs of wear, corrosion, or damage. Operators should check for uneven wear patterns on the sheave grooves and ensure that the sheave is properly aligned with the lifting system.
4.2 Lubrication and Wear Monitoring
Proper lubrication reduces friction and wear on the sheaves. Operators should regularly lubricate the bearing surfaces and monitor for any signs of excessive wear, replacing sheaves as needed.
5. Installation Best Practices for Crane Sheaves
Correct installation of crane sheaves is vital for maintaining safety in lifting operations. Key considerations include:
- Ensuring alignment with the lifting system to prevent undue stress on the ropes.
- Using appropriate fasteners and connectors to secure sheaves in place.
- Following manufacturer guidelines for installation procedures.
Improper installation can compromise the safety of lifting operations and lead to accidents.

7. Industry Standards and Regulations for Crane Safety
Compliance with industry standards and regulations is critical for maintaining safety in lifting operations. Organizations such as the Occupational Safety and Health Administration (OSHA) and the American National Standards Institute (ANSI) provide guidelines for crane operations, including the use of sheaves.
Adhering to these standards not only enhances safety but also protects operators from legal liabilities. Regular training and education on these regulations can significantly improve safety practices in the workplace.
